Lehman Brothers surprised at 0.5% rate hike

Fri, 13 Jun 2008 17:02


Global analysts the Lehman Brothers said that the Reserve Bank's 50 basis point hike is inconsistent with South Africa's inflation outlook. Lehman Brothers say that the lower than expected rate hike contradicts the governor Tito Mboweni's own statement about taking 'drastic action' to contain inflation.

At the monetary policy announcement yesterday, Governor Mboweni said that consumer inflation in the country is seen peaking at around 12% in the third quarter and not seen returning to the 3% to 6% target band.
